About Clermont 4721

The size of Clermont is approximately 5,145.1 square kilometres. It has 20 parks covering nearly 14.1% of total area. The population of Clermont in 2011 was 3,057 people. By 2016 the population was 3,030 showing a population decline of 0.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Clermont is 0-9 years. Households in Clermont are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Clermont work in a machinery operators and drivers occupation. In 2011, 56.8% of the homes in Clermont were owner-occupied compared with 56.2% in 2016.
